What is Flier EV-to-FCF?

Flier TSE:323A -3.16% 5 EV-to-FCF is 50.05 as of Jul. 17, 2026, which is 28% above its 10-year median of 39.14. GuruFocus rates TSE:323A with a GF Score™ of 5/100. The stock has 7 warning signs investors should review. Among 1,595 Software companies, Flier ranks worse than 84.83% on this metric.

EV-to-FCF is calculated as enterprise value divided by its free cash flow. As of today, Flier's Enterprise Value is 円1,293 Mil. Flier's Free Cash Flow for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Feb. 2026 was 円26 Mil. Therefore, Flier's EV-to-FCF for today is 50.05.

Enterprise Value is used because it is a more complete measure in reflecting how much an investor pays when buying a company. Free Cash Flow is an important financial metric because it represents the actual amount of cash at a company's disposal. Companies with a low EV-to-FCF ratio, combined with a strong balance sheet are generally considered as undervalued.

Flier Business Description

Address 1-1-1 Hitotsubashi, Chiyoda-ku, Tokyo, JPN, 100-0003
Flier Inc is engaged in developing and managing business book summary service flier and flier business. Flier Business is a corporate human resource development service centered on book summaries. Its products are based on individual and organizational growth's dual aims.
